A Role of Compounding Pharmacies in Tailored Medicine
As contemporary healthcare moves towards personalized treatment, custom pharmacies are fulfilling an increasingly vital role. These dispensaries offer the opportunity to formulate medications tailored to a individual's unique requirements . Unlike traditional pharmaceutical producers, compounding pharmacists can adjust dosages, combine various ingredients, and offer formulations that resolve the unique challenges faced by particular patients, essentially improving therapeutic effects and patient well-being. This increasing priority positions compounding pharmacies at the forefront of individualized medicine.
Key Drug Components: Which They Represent and How They Matter
Medicinal Drug Substances (APIs) are the portion of a medication that delivers the intended impact on the body. Essentially, they represent the primary component responsible for the therapeutic outcome. Knowing APIs is important because their quality directly influences the performance and potency of the final treatment. Differences in API production or source can cause significant differences in patient outcomes and present potential hazards.

Beyond the Pill: Exploring the World of Custom Drugstores
While most patients are acquainted with standard pharmacies offering mass-produced medications, a growing number of pharmaceutical professionals are learning about the advantages of compounding pharmacies. These niche establishments create prescriptions tailored to meet individual patient requirements , often overcoming limitations of off-the-shelf options, such as allergy reactions or dosage requirements. From sweetening medications for kids to developing solutions for those with difficulty swallowing, personalized medicine providers offer a significant level of customization care.
